Decoding Dog Language: Understanding Your furry Friend
Unlocking the mysteries of canine communication is a rewarding journey that deepens your bond with your four-legged bud. Dogs share through a complex system involving body language, vocalizations, and scent signals. Observe carefully subtle shifts in their posture as these provide insights into their emotions.
- A wagging tail doesn't always mean excitement, it can also suggest anticipation or even anxiety.
- Whining can have multiple meanings, ranging from boredom to warning.
- Decipher your dog's individual behaviors to build a stronger, more meaningful connection.
Top Tips for Training Your Pup
Raising a well-behaved pup is truly rewarding! Here are some tips to help you on your journey. First and foremost, begin training early. Puppies learn best when they're young, so even basic instructions like "sit" and "stay" are important. Consistency is key! Use the same phrases for each cue and get more info always praise good behavior.
Make training fun and stimulating for your pup with plenty of playtime and positive reinforcement. Avoid punishment as it can harm your bond and make learning challenging.
Be patient! Training a puppy takes time, effort, and lots of love. Don't get discouraged if you don't see results immediately. Just remember to keep it fun and praise your pup for every little success.

Unveiling the Story of Domesticated Canines
Dogs, faithful canine buddies, have a rich history that spans thousands of years. First appearing from their wolf ancestors, dogs over time became domesticated, evolving into the diverse array of breeds we know today. The exact process of domestication remains a subject of inquiry, but evidence suggests it likely started in Eurasia somewhere between 15,000 and 40,000 years ago.
- Ancient dogs were likely used to help with hunting, protecting livestock, and even providing companionship.
- As human societies progressed, so too did the roles of dogs. They became increasingly refined for specific purposes, leading to the development of distinct breeds with unique traits and abilities.
- Today's dog breeds exemplify the remarkable adaptability and diversity of these animals. From the loyal Golden Retriever to the independent Siberian Husky, each breed has its own story to tell.
The history and evolution of dogs continue to be an active area of research. By learning about their past, we gain a deeper appreciation for these compassionate creatures and the enduring bond they share with humans.
